Binary

bin

Definition

Binary is a base-2 numeral system using only digits 0 and 1. It is fundamental to computer science and digital electronics, representing data in the most basic form that computers can process.

History/Origin

Binary notation was developed by Gottfried Leibniz in the 17th century, though the concept dates back to ancient civilizations. It became essential with the advent of digital computers in the 20th century.

Current Use

Binary is used in computer programming, digital circuits, data storage systems, and all digital technology. It forms the foundation of how computers process and store information.
